Notre-Dame de Macnider, Quebec (1911 census)
Notre-Dame de Macnider was a census subdivision in Quebec, recorded in the 1911 Census of Canada with a population of 1,769. The administrative centroid was at approximately 48.694°N, 67.877°W.
Population
In 1911, Notre-Dame de Macnider had a population of 1,769: 908 male and 861 female residents. Population density was 48.4 people per square mile.
Population trajectory across census years
| Year | Population |
|---|---|
| 1901 | 1,908 |
| 1911 | 1,769 |
| 1921 | 1,703 |
